Meta has acquired Manus, a Chinese-founded AI agent startup, for an estimated 2 billion to 3 billion dollars. This move signals a pivot from chatbots to autonomous agents capable of executing complex digital tasks independently. Manus notably reached 125 million dollars in ARR within just eight months, proving the commercial scale of agentic AI. This acquisition reflects a systemic consolidation as Big Tech secures the execution layer of the AI stack. 🚀
